11/57-63 Cecil Ave, Castle Hill is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2003. The property has a land size of 4050m2 and floor size of 148m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2019.

The size of Castle Hill is approximately 18.9 square kilometres. It has 68 parks covering nearly 12.1% of total area. The population of Castle Hill in 2016 was 39594 people. By 2021 the population was 40874 showing a population growth of 3.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Castle Hill is 40-49 years. Households in Castle Hill are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Castle Hill work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 72.40% of the homes in Castle Hill were owner-occupied compared with 74.50% in 2016.
